TTGO T-Beam V1.0 Lora32 X1276 Lora con GPS y soporte de batería
Este es una placa programable con un controlador ESP32 que ofrece 26 pines con GPIO, ADC, VP / VN, DAC, táctil, SPI, I2C, UART, pin 2 x LoRa y señales de alimentación (5V / 3.3V / GND). También hay dos botones en la placa: uno es para alimentación, pero el segundo está conectado al pin GPIO39 del ESP32.
La placa se puede programar utilizando el entorno de desarrollo Arduino, y enviar y recibir datos a través de LoRa. Al voltear la placa hay un soporte de batería para una celda de iones de litio 18650, y aunque puede parecer una batería AA “estándar”, es significativamente diferente. Por lo tanto, no cometa el error de sustituir la batería AA más común para intentar alimentar la placa. No son del mismo tamaño.
OPCIONAL: Se le puede montar una Pantalla oled .
¿Qué es el ESP32?
El ESP32 es un SoC (System on Chip) diseñado por la compañía china Espressif y fabricado por TSMC. Integra en un único chip un procesador Tensilica Xtensa de doble núcleo de 32bits a 160Mhz (con posibilidad de hasta 240Mhz), conectividad WiFi y Bluetooth.
El ESP32 añade muchas funciones y mejoras respecto a el ESP8266, como son mayor potencia, Bluetooth 4.0, encriptación por hadware, sensor de temperatura, sensor hall, sensor táctil, reloj de tiempo real (RTC). más puertos, más buses… ¡más de todo!
Compararemos ambos modelos con más detalle en la próxima entrada, pero ya vemos que es muy superior al ESP8266. A cambio, lógicamente, el precio es ligeramente superior. Pero, aun así, es espectacular en características/precio.
Como no podía ser de otra forma, la comunidad Maker acogió el nuevo ESP32 con los brazos abiertos. Se han desarrollado firmwares, documentación, herramientas y, aunque su soporte es aún inferior al del ESP8266, en la actualidad es fácil encontrar tutoriales sobre el mismo y continuamente se publican nuevos artículos.
Por supuesto, los fabricantes están atentos y han desarrollado numerosas placas de desarrollo que integran el ESP32. Algunas tienen baterías LiPo tipo 16050, otras TFT, otras pantallas OLED, comunicación por Lora… Y cada vez aparecen nuevas opciones, algunas realmente interesantes.
También empiezan a verse artículos y productos comerciales que emplean el ESP32 como núcleo. No obstante, de momento, encontramos más artículos que montan el ESP8266, seguramente por su bajo precio o llevas más tiempo en el mercado. No obstante, puede que esta tendencia se acabe invirtiendo y veamos un mayor número de productos comerciales basados en el ESP32, dada su mayor potencia e incluir Bluetooth BLE.
En cuanto a lenguajes de programación tenemos varias opciones, básicamente similares a las que vimos en ESP8266. Es posible emplear el IDE de Arduino, instalar MicroPython, RTOS, Mongoose OS, Espruino.
En definitiva, una máquina muy interesante y que nos va a dar mucho juego. Tiene un potencial enorme para elaborar todo tipo de proyectos, sobre por su capacidad de comunicación, ocupando un lugar destacado en aplicaciones de IoT.
Características
-
- Dimensiones 100 x 33 mm
- Voltaje de funcionamiento: 3,3-7 V
- Corriente aceptable: 10 ~ 14mA
- Adaptador USB chip: CP2102
- Frecuencia dominante: 240 MHZ
- LoRa chip: SX1276
- Banda de frecuencia de soporte: 868-915 MHZ
- Distancia abierta de la comunicación: 2,8 KM
- Procesador: Tensilica LX6 de doble núcleo
- Maestro chip: ESP32
- Capacidad de cálculo: hasta 600 DMIPS
- Flash: 32 M Bits
- Bluetooth de doble modo: Bluetooth tradicional y Bluetooth BLE de baja potencia
- Temperatura de funcionamiento:-40 ℃- + 85 ℃
- Sensibilidad del receptor:-139dBm (SF12, 125 KHZ)
- Rendimiento continuo UDP: 135 Mbps
- Modo de soporte: Sniffer, estación, softAP y Wi-Fi directo
- Potencia de transmisión: 19.5dBm @ 11b, 16.5dBm @ 11g, 15.5dBm @ 11n
- Tasa de datos: 150 Mbps @ 11n HT40, 72 Mbps @ 11n HT20, 54 Mbps @ 11g 11 Mbps @ 11b
- Formulario de interfaz: SPI
-
Velocidad de datos: 1.2K ~ 300Kbps @ FSK, 0.018K~37.5Kbps@LoRa
-
Modo de modulación: FSK, GFSK, MSK, GMSK, LoRa TM, OOK
- Corriente de reposo: 0.2uA@SLEEP, 1.5uA@IDLE
- Gestión de la batería 1A
-
Corrección de frecuencia automática
-
Control de ganancia automática
-
Función de reactivación de RF
-
Detección de baja tensión y sensor de temperatura
-
Módulo GPS NEO-6M, fuente de alimentación universal 3V-5V
-
Módulo especificado con antena de cerámica, señal súper fuerte
-
Guardar datos de parámetros de configuración EEPROM Down
-
Con batería de respaldo de datos
- Velocidad de transmisión predeterminada: 9600
Enlaces externos
Valoraciones
No hay valoraciones aún.